Bottle 500ml. w. swing top @ home. [ As Klosterbräuerei Mächern Weihnachts Festbier ].Clear medium orange yellow colour with a average to large, frothy, good lacing, mostly lasting, off-white head. Aroma is moderate to light heavy malty, pale malt, sweet malt, fruity malt, light to moderate hoppy, flowers, fruity hops. Flavor is moderate to heavy sweet and light to moderate bitter with a long duration, fruity malt, sweet malt, pale malt, flowers, bock malt, light fruity hops. Body is medium, texture is oily to watery, carbonation is soft. [20180122] 7-3-7-3-15

Bottle 500ml. w. swing top @ home. [ As Klosterbräuerei Mächern Dunkel Weizen ].Hazy - murky medium amber colour with a average to large, frothy, good lacing, mostly lasting, off-white to light light beige head. Aroma is moderate malty, wheat, bread, caramel, moderate yeasty, fruity yeast, weizen yeast, light banana. Flavor is moderate sweet with a long duration, caramel, sweet malt, sweet yeast, fruity yeast, weizen yeast. Body is medium, texture is oily, carbonation is soft. [20180121] 6-3-7-3-13

Bottle from my Secret Santa's package, thank you Beerhunter 111! Pours brown, some beige foam at first but reduces quickly. Nose has some light caramel, wet baked bread and berry jam without sweetness. Taste is quite acidic, pretty tart. Not really what I expected actually, possibly gone sour and not intended to be like this. Residual sugars are gone, light caramel and bready malts. Sour linger lasting into aftertaste, dry bready finish.

Bottle from my Secret Santa package. Pours clear golden, some white foam that does not stay for long. Light biscuits in the nose, touch of herbal hop spice. Tastes quite full bodied, more than its looks are hinting. Heavy and thick, although does not look that way. Biscuits and light herbal caramel. Light bitterness coming out in the finish. Good with food.
